Output 88937964bb4761c4c775c88d8c0790f6ebd7a57ea72dce2cf5c8e5cf921e17ca:62

value
751563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d264757e22479de27650195e2d60aa9855701737 OP_EQUAL
address
3LsUAqbruyCGXgbSy4WPKMVGLD7UE78UBV
transaction
88937964bb4761c4c775c88d8c0790f6ebd7a57ea72dce2cf5c8e5cf921e17ca
spent
true